2025-10-24 01:16:50 +07:00

56 lines
1.9 KiB
Dart

// GENERATED CODE - DO NOT MODIFY BY HAND
part of 'auth_dtos.dart';
// **************************************************************************
// JsonSerializableGenerator
// **************************************************************************
_$LoginDtoImpl _$$LoginDtoImplFromJson(Map<String, dynamic> json) =>
_$LoginDtoImpl(
token: json['token'] as String?,
refreshToken: json['refresh_token'] as String?,
expiresAt: json['expires_at'] as String?,
refreshExpiresAt: json['refresh_expires_at'] as String?,
user: json['user'] == null
? null
: UserDto.fromJson(json['user'] as Map<String, dynamic>),
);
Map<String, dynamic> _$$LoginDtoImplToJson(_$LoginDtoImpl instance) =>
<String, dynamic>{
'token': instance.token,
'refresh_token': instance.refreshToken,
'expires_at': instance.expiresAt,
'refresh_expires_at': instance.refreshExpiresAt,
'user': instance.user,
};
_$UserDtoImpl _$$UserDtoImplFromJson(Map<String, dynamic> json) =>
_$UserDtoImpl(
id: json['id'] as String?,
organizationId: json['organization_id'] as String?,
outletId: json['outlet_id'] as String?,
name: json['name'] as String?,
email: json['email'] as String?,
role: json['role'] as String?,
permissions: json['permissions'] as Map<String, dynamic>?,
isActive: json['is_active'] as bool?,
createdAt: json['created_at'] as String?,
updatedAt: json['updated_at'] as String?,
);
Map<String, dynamic> _$$UserDtoImplToJson(_$UserDtoImpl instance) =>
<String, dynamic>{
'id': instance.id,
'organization_id': instance.organizationId,
'outlet_id': instance.outletId,
'name': instance.name,
'email': instance.email,
'role': instance.role,
'permissions': instance.permissions,
'is_active': instance.isActive,
'created_at': instance.createdAt,
'updated_at': instance.updatedAt,
};